MOVIE PREVIEW OF “ARUSI PERSIAN WEDDING” <br>
Culture Clash Tests the Limits of a Couple Preparing for their Wedding <br><br>
FREE PROGRAM HOSTED BY THE SAN DIEGO PUBLIC LIBRARY AS PART OF ITS ITVS COMMUNITY CINEMA SERIES IN COLLABORATION WITH MEDIA ARTS CENTER SAN DIEGO AND PERSIAN CULTURAL CENTER <br><br>
Iranian-American filmmaker, Marjan Tehrani, tells the story of an Iranian-American and his American fiancée who go back to Iran to hold a traditional wedding. A “must-see” for those interested in community cinema, this film has been described as a heartfelt, hopeful, and revealing love story set against a politically tumultuous and culturally rich background to bring perspective and understanding to larger US-Iranian relations. <br><br>
Distinguished psychologist, Dr. Cyrus Nakhshab, will facilitate a discussion following the screening <br>
